SUMMARY Implement Bahtinov focus in Ekos. Allow focus using a Bahtinov mask. This should be an expansion of the current focus implementation in kstars/Ekos. As Bahtinov focus is usually done on one star at the time, the auto select star should be disabled, forcing the user to select the star on which to perform the Bahtinov focus algorithm. For the Bahtinov focus algorithm the algorithm used in the Bahtinov-grabber project can be used (and adapted to fit in kstars/Ekos). STEPS TO REPRODUCE 1. Point your telescope at a bright star and place the Bahtinov mask on your telescope 2. Start kstars 3. Open Ekos 4. Connect to camera 5. Select focus tab 6. Select detection algorithm Bahtinov 7. Capture an image 8. Select star in image 9. The Bahtinov lines will be shown in the image and the HFR (or focus error) is shown below the V-Curve OBSERVED RESULT Not applicable as it is a new feature EXPECTED RESULT Assist in focus using a Bahtinov mask SOFTWARE/OS VERSIONS All supported OS.
